To perform a self-clean cycle, remove all oven racks and accessories. Close the oven door, press the 'Self Clean' button, and select the desired cleaning duration. Confirm by pressing 'Start'. The oven will lock and begin the cleaning process.

To calibrate the oven temperature, press and hold the 'Bake' button for several seconds until the display shows the calibration screen. Use the 'Up' or 'Down' arrows to adjust the temperature offset. Press 'Start' to save the changes.
It is normal to smell a burning odor during the first use due to the manufacturing process. To minimize the smell, run the oven at a high temperature for an hour with good ventilation.
To use the convection feature, press the 'Convection' button and set the desired temperature using the number keys. Confirm by pressing 'Start'. The convection fan will circulate hot air for even cooking.
Regularly clean the cooktop with a soft cloth or sponge and a non-abrasive cleaner. Avoid using harsh chemicals or steel wool, which can damage the surface. Inspect for cracks or damages routinely.

Yes, aluminum foil can be used in the oven. However, do not cover the oven's bottom or the entire rack as it can interfere with heat circulation and cause poor cooking results.
Remove the racks and soak them in warm, soapy water. Use a non-abrasive scrubber to remove any residue. Rinse thoroughly and dry before placing them back in the oven.
To lock the control panel, press and hold the 'Lock' button for three seconds until the lock icon appears on the display. To unlock, press and hold the 'Lock' button again for three seconds.
